Comprehending the Online Pharmacy Landscape
Not all online pharmacies operate the same way. Usually, they can be classified into three unique types:
- Domestically Licensed Retail Pharmacies: These are the online storefronts of traditional, brick-and-mortar pharmacies operating within your home nation (e.g., CVS, Walgreens, or independent local drug stores).
- Online-Only Domestic Pharmacies: These services run completely online however are accredited within the country of home and require a valid, doctor-issued prescription.
- International or Canadian Pharmacies: These pharmacies run outside the consumer's home country. While some individuals utilize them to access lower costs, they frequently bring legal and safety gray areas depending upon local policies.
Secret Indicators of a Legitimate Online Pharmacy
Before sending payment or medical details, consumers should validate the credibility of the online drug store. A credible platform will always display specific regulatory markers.
- Needs a Valid Prescription: A genuine pharmacy will never ever dispense prescription-only medication without a prescription provided by a licensed healthcare company.
- Physical Address and Phone Number: Valid pharmacies provide clear, available contact details, including a physical business address and a customer care telephone number.
- Certified by State or National Boards: In the United States, legitimate online drug stores are usually accredited by their state board of pharmacy. International pharmacies need to be vetted through acknowledged regulatory bodies.
- Uses a Licensed Pharmacist: Reputable platforms offer access to signed up pharmacists who can address concerns relating to medication interactions, adverse effects, and dosing.

Buying medications online securely involves a systematic approach to protect both health and financial information.
1. Speak With a Healthcare Provider
Constantly start by talking about medication needs with a primary care physician. They can provide a precise medical diagnosis, write the needed prescription, and discuss potential drug interactions.
2. Validate the Pharmacy's Credentials
Search for verification seals. In the U.S., search for the VIPPS (Verified Internet Pharmacy Practice Sites) seal or inspect listings provided by the National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P).
3. Check Payment and Data Security
Guarantee the website utilizes safe encryption procedures. Look for "https://" in the web address and a padlock icon in the internet browser bar before entering credit card info or delicate case history.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I purchase prescription drugs online without a medical professional's prescription?
No. In a lot of jurisdictions, it is both unlawful and unsafe to acquire prescription medications without a valid prescription from a certified doctor. Sites offering prescription drugs without a prescription are operating illegally and might sell fake or unsafe products.
Are online pharmacies cheaper than regional pharmacies?
Often, yes. Online pharmacies may have lower overhead expenses, enabling them to pass savings on to customers. Furthermore, online discount rate cards and price-comparison tools can help discover the most affordable market rate. However, consumers should constantly stabilize cost with safety and validate the pharmacy's authenticity.
Does insurance cover medications bought online?
Many insurance coverage strategies cover medications purchased through mail-order pharmacies affiliated with the insurance coverage company or authorized network partners. Consumers must consult their specific insurance provider to confirm network eligibility before purchasing.
How can I tell if an online pharmacy is safe?
Examine if the pharmacy requires a valid prescription, offers a physical address and phone number, uses a licensed pharmacist, and holds correct accreditation (such as NABP/VIPPS certification in the United States).
Is it safe to purchase medications from other nations?
Buying medications from international online drug stores brings fundamental risks. While some countries keep rigorous regulations, others do not.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), for example, keeps in mind that importing unapproved prescription drugs from foreign sources is generally prohibited and presents threats relating to product quality, purity, and appropriate dose.
